- The distance between Tessalit, Mali and San Juan Bautista, Paraguay is approximately 8,146 km or 5,062 mi.
- To reach Tessalit in this distance one would set out from San Juan Bautista bearing 56.3°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Tessalit bearing 52.4° or NE .
- Tessalit has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as San Juan Bautista has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Tessalit is in or near the tropical desert biome whereas San Juan Bautista is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 7.7 °C (13.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.8 °C (10.4°F) more in Tessalit.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1604.1 mm (63.2 in) less which is equivalent to 1604.1 l/m² (39.37 US gal/ft²) or 16,041,000 l/ha (1,714,889 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.5° higher in Tessalit than in San Juan Bautista.
- Relative humidity levels are 50.9%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 13.4°C (24.1°F) lower.
